The Peripheral IV markets are approaching $4B, and are expected to continue growth rates above 6% through 2022. During their hospital stay 60%-90% of patients require peripheral intravenous catheter (PIVC) and, even in the most rigorously performed studies, the overall failure rate is between 35%-50%.  For more information click here.
